Sharon frequently causes diarrhea in her three-year-old daughter by feeding her spoiled milk and rotten eggs. When the child is repeatedly hospitalized, Sharon acts like a very worried and caring mother. Because Sharon is not playing the sick role and receives no obvious reward for her behavior, her appropriate diagnosis is ____

a. complex somatic symptom disorder with somatization features (somatization disorder)
b. factitious disorder
c. factitious disorder imposed on another
d. malingering


c
